Introduction to OpenAI's Bias Reduction Efforts
OpenAI's commitment to reducing bias in its language models is a testament to its dedication to enhancing AI neutrality and user trust. With the introduction of GPT‑5, OpenAI has implemented significant improvements in minimizing political bias. According to Qazinform, these efforts have led to a measurable 30% reduction in bias compared to previous iterations like GPT‑4o and GPT‑3. This progress is particularly crucial in promoting a neutral AI environment where users can engage with information that is not skewed by political ideologies.
Measuring political bias in AI is a complex challenge, yet OpenAI's advancements with GPT‑5 mark a significant step forward. The system is designed to respond more neutrally to a range of prompts, particularly those that are neutral or only slightly biased. However, when confronted with highly charged or provocative political prompts, bias can still occasionally manifest. Despite this, OpenAI's research indicates that political bias is infrequent, appearing in less than 0.01% of all ChatGPT responses in typical usage, largely because politically charged questions are not common in everyday interactions.

Measuring Political Bias in GPT Models
In the complex landscape of large language models (LLMs), measuring political bias remains a nuanced challenge. OpenAI's latest efforts with ChatGPT, particularly in its GPT‑5 iteration, highlight a focused attempt to reduce such biases. According to current evaluations, these models are judged against specific behavioral axes, including personal political expression, emotional language escalation, and more. This approach not only seeks to reduce bias but also aims for a more balanced interaction model when confronted with politically charged queries.
While GPT‑5 demonstrates a measurable reduction in political bias—approximately 30% compared to its predecessors—measuring this bias involves more than just statistical analysis. According to research, it includes evaluating responses to prompts that vary in political slant and emotional intensity. By systematically recording these interactions, OpenAI develops scoring metrics to identify where biases manifest and how they can be mitigated. This methodology underscores the importance of considering context and user intent in AI response evaluation.
Understanding political bias in AI models like ChatGPT also involves assessing the complexity of biases inherently linked to content moderation guidelines. As noted by OpenAI, these guidelines aim to avoid hate speech and misinformation but can inadvertently impose a perceived bias. Balancing these safety parameters with genuine neutrality is pivotal as OpenAI continues to refine its models, a task that requires both technical ingenuity and careful ethical consideration. Defining bias within AI systems is inherently challenging due to its multifaceted nature. Bias often arises from alignment principles designed to prevent the AI from promoting harmful ideologies or misinformation. However, these same principles can lead to perceptions of a left‑leaning stance, a byproduct of prioritizing content that aligns with widely accepted societal norms. As such, OpenAI's modifications in GPT‑5 are not solely about achieving absolute truth but about sculpting a more neutral information tool. This nuanced approach enables AI to handle diverse viewpoints while upholding ethical standards and safety guidelines, which are crucial in maintaining a balanced AI ecosystem.

Criticisms of OpenAI's Approach to Bias
OpenAI’s approach to managing bias, specifically political bias, within its AI models like ChatGPT, has sparked considerable debate and critique. While the company's efforts to reduce political bias are notable, critics argue that these changes may not be sufficient or may inadvertently sideline important discussions. OpenAI’s decision to pursue neutrality by making the AI less likely to engage in politically charged topics has raised concerns about sacrificing meaningful engagement for the sake of perceived neutrality.
One of the most pressing criticisms of OpenAI's current strategy is that by aiming for neutrality, the AI may become less informative and possibly less relevant when it skirts around controversial or complex political issues. This perception is compounded by the understanding that true neutrality is difficult to define and achieve, especially in such a politically fragmented global landscape. Critics suggest that the AI's tendency to avoid polarizing topics might limit its utility and diminish user engagement, particularly from those who seek more in‑depth analysis or discussion from AI.
Furthermore, some argue that the framework employed by OpenAI to measure bias might focus more on avoiding controversy instead of fostering comprehensive or enlightening dialogue. This could create a scenario where AI‑generated responses are sanitized to the extent that they fail to address the crux of politically sensitive issues. Critics point out that meaningful discourse often involves confronting hard truths and engaging with conflicting viewpoints, elements that may currently be minimized under OpenAI's model specifications.
